<title>drm/amd/display: Use freesync when `DRM_EDID_FEATURE_CONTINUOUS_FREQ` found</title>
<updated>2024-04-03T13:32:31+00:00</updated>
<author>
<name>Mario Limonciello</name>
<email>mario.limonciello@amd.com</email>
</author>
<published>2024-03-05T20:34:24+00:00</published>
<link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='https://git.tavy.me/linux-stable.git/commit/?id=23769fa6df257091bf401c52c2a8d307239e5531'/>
<id>23769fa6df257091bf401c52c2a8d307239e5531</id>
<content type='text'>
commit 2f14c0c8cae8e9e3b603a3f91909baba66540027 upstream.

The monitor shipped with the Framework 16 supports VRR [1], but it's not
being advertised.

This is because the detailed timing block doesn't contain
`EDID_DETAIL_MONITOR_RANGE` which amdgpu looks for to find min and max
frequencies.  This check however is superfluous for this case because
update_display_info() calls drm_get_monitor_range() to get these ranges
already.

So if the `DRM_EDID_FEATURE_CONTINUOUS_FREQ` EDID feature is found then
turn on freesync without extra checks.

<title>drm/amdgpu/display: Address kdoc for 'is_psr_su' in 'fill_dc_dirty_rects'</title>
<updated>2024-04-03T13:32:06+00:00</updated>
<author>
<name>Srinivasan Shanmugam</name>
<email>srinivasan.shanmugam@amd.com</email>
</author>
<published>2024-02-15T12:55:40+00:00</published>
<link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='https://git.tavy.me/linux-stable.git/commit/?id=612cdcdc282fb9f02962cade6f9a50dc3eb4d6cf'/>
<id>612cdcdc282fb9f02962cade6f9a50dc3eb4d6cf</id>
<content type='text'>
[ Upstream commit 3651306ae4c7f3f54caa9feb826a93cc69ccebbf ]

The is_psr_su parameter is a boolean flag indicating whether the Panel
Self Refresh Selective Update (PSR SU) feature is enabled which is a
power-saving feature that allows only the updated regions of the screen
to be refreshed, reducing the amount of data that needs to be sent to
the display.

<title>drm/amd/display: fix NULL checks for adev-&gt;dm.dc in amdgpu_dm_fini()</title>
<updated>2024-03-26T22:17:05+00:00</updated>
<author>
<name>Nikita Zhandarovich</name>
<email>n.zhandarovich@fintech.ru</email>
</author>
<published>2024-02-06T16:50:56+00:00</published>
<link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='https://git.tavy.me/linux-stable.git/commit/?id=1c62697e4086de988b31124fb8c79c244ea05f2b'/>
<id>1c62697e4086de988b31124fb8c79c244ea05f2b</id>
<content type='text'>
[ Upstream commit 2a3cfb9a24a28da9cc13d2c525a76548865e182c ]

Since 'adev-&gt;dm.dc' in amdgpu_dm_fini() might turn out to be NULL
before the call to dc_enable_dmub_notifications(), check
beforehand to ensure there will not be a possible NULL-ptr-deref
there.

Also, since commit 1e88eb1b2c25 ("drm/amd/display: Drop
CONFIG_DRM_AMD_DC_HDCP") there are two separate checks for NULL in
'adev-&gt;dm.dc' before dc_deinit_callbacks() and dc_dmub_srv_destroy().
Clean up by combining them all under one 'if'.

Found by Linux Verification Center (linuxtesting.org) with static
analysis tool SVACE.
